Some builders will entertain this option. Many builders need to get rid of inventory, and are struggling at this point. If you present an offer to them that lowers their monthly payment, and will get them a reasonably priced listing, they may consider it. In my experience, the buyer will need to price their home about 10% less than appraised value. That will give the builder some incentive to trade. He will probably list your home immediately with a realtor, and that will cost him 6%, so he is gaining 4% if he sells in immediately.
